Hello everyone, my name is Andrew Feldstein and I am the founding/managing partner of Feldstein Family Law Group. Today I will be discussing the significance of a Separation Agreement, even between two amicable and co-operative former spouses. That is, I will be discussing the need for a Separation Agreement regardless of how well you and your former partner get along after the decision to separate from one another. A Separation Agreement is negotiated between the parties and can potentially settle all rights and obligations arising out of a common-law relationship or marriage. Former spouses are provided with the closest thing to certainty, finality, and closure by entering into a Separation Agreement. Furthermore, a Separation Agreement provides structure to the parties relationship moving forward, a period of time referred to as post-separation. A separation agreement or other written document is not required to be legally separated in North Carolina. To be considered separated from your spouse, you need to be living in different homes, and at least one of you needs to intend that the separation be permanent.
When two people who have been living together in a marriage, or a marriage-like relationship (sometimes called a common-law relationship), decide not to live together any more, they are separated. There is no such thing as a legal separation. If you are living apart, you are separated.

You and your spouse can write the agreement yourselves or you can ask a lawyer, family justice counsellor, or private mediator to help you. If you decide to write your own agreement, read as much as you can about separation agreements before you start to write it.
The date you start to live separate and apart from your spouse becomes the date of separation. Separation can exist even where you continue to occupy the family home. It is evidenced for example by living a completely separate life taking meals at different times, organising the household chores separately etc.
